  • Wire Wheels are Available for the following years:
     

  • 1955-1956 15 X 5

  • 1957 14 X 5

  • 1958-1963 14 X 5.5  

  • 1964 15 X 6

  • 1965-1967 15 X 6

  • Post 1967 - Please call for your application
     

  • Continental Kit? If you are planning on running a steel belted radial tire, it is possible that the tire will not fit in your Continental kit due to dimensions differing from the original bias-ply tires. Please discuss this with us. We cannot guarantee whether a tire will fit in your Kit due to varying dimensions.

Compare our wire wheels to the competition

Features

Our wheels Competition
Construction Hand-made in California. Exact-fit hub specially made for each year Thunderbird. Built in a far-off land. Hub often generic style to fit all types of cars leading to incorrect fit. 
Chrome-plating Superior chrome plating and construction. A wire wheel you can be proud of. Unknown amount of plating - often inferior quality. Yellowish appearance. Back of wheel not polished. Peeling chrome.
Plating method Entire rim is polished and plated front and back and all parts chrome plated first and then  individually assembled. Plated and polished on front side of rim only and pre-assembled before plating. The result is an inferior appearance and rust protection.
Fit Guaranteed to fit including fender skirts. Correct back-spacing for each year Thunderbird. Clearance problems particularly with spinner hitting skirts. One size fits all backspacing.
Quality Control Every set is gauge-tested twice for accuracy. All spokes expertly trued not requiring future truing. Often wheels wobble, loose spokes and pitted chrome. Frequent truing may be required.
Spinner caps Made from steel with correct emblems. Securely fit and do not rotate or fly off. Plastic often used or incorrect appearing style. Vibration and noise due to poor fit. Gasket required.
